Output e4c867128b4dab276a1c5d14d8915c8a0085d4e7edf2d4e0fc518fb963daa7cb:1

value
95436
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 53a8e129536fc3eb16422d0e3964fe7b91c527fd10b9457b3975863acc7b14ca
address
bc1p2w5wz22ndlp7k9jz958rje870wgu2flazzu527eewkrr4nrmzn9qgehmqd
transaction
e4c867128b4dab276a1c5d14d8915c8a0085d4e7edf2d4e0fc518fb963daa7cb
confirmations
21034
spent
true